How much does it cost to rent a home in St Elizabeths?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| St Elizabeths 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,184 | $1,330 | $5,750 |
| St Elizabeths 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,911 | $1,150 | $10,000+ |
| St Elizabeths 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,503 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| St Elizabeths 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,470 | $675 | $10,000+ |
| St Elizabeths 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,071 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| St Elizabeths 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,490 | $950 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about St Elizabeths
What type of rentals are currently available in St Elizabeths?
There are currently 3083 Apartments for Rent in St Elizabeths, MA with pricing that ranges from $1,000 to $17,000. There are also 3834 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in St Elizabeths ranging from $675 to $17,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in St Elizabeths?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in St Elizabeths ranges from $675 to $17,000 with an average monthly rent of $5,471.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in St Elizabeths?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in St Elizabeths range from $2,054 to $14,411,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,150 to $11,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$900 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,295.
